Overview

The FAN6961 is a highly efficient integrated circuit designed for switch-mode power supply (SMPS) applications. It is widely used in power management systems due to its ability to regulate and control power delivery with minimal energy loss. The IC is favored in industrial and consumer electronics for its compact design and robust performance. Developed by Fairchild Semiconductor (now part of ON Semiconductor), the FAN6961 incorporates advanced features such as over-voltage protection and low standby power consumption. These attributes make it a preferred choice for manufacturers aiming to meet energy efficiency standards.

Structure and Working Principle

The FAN6961 operates as a pulse-width modulation (PWM) controller, regulating the power supply by adjusting the duty cycle of the switching signal. It integrates key components like a reference voltage generator, error amplifier, and oscillator, ensuring precise control over output voltage and current. Its working principle involves comparing the output voltage feedback with a reference voltage to generate an error signal. This signal adjusts the PWM duty cycle, maintaining stable power delivery even under varying load conditions. The IC’s design minimizes external component count, simplifying circuit board layouts.

Key Features

The FAN6961 stands out for its high efficiency, often exceeding 90% in typical applications. It supports a wide input voltage range, making it versatile for various power supply designs. The IC also includes built-in protections against over-voltage, under-voltage, and over-current, enhancing system reliability. Another notable feature is its low standby power consumption, which aligns with global energy-saving regulations. The device’s compact footprint and minimal external component requirements further reduce manufacturing costs and board space.

Application Areas

The FAN6961 is commonly used in AC-DC converters for consumer electronics, such as LED drivers, adapters, and set-top boxes. Its reliability and efficiency also make it suitable for industrial power supplies, including telecom equipment and server power systems. In addition, the IC is employed in renewable energy systems, such as solar inverters, where stable and efficient power management is critical. Its adaptability to high-frequency switching applications further expands its use in advanced power electronics.

Maintenance and Precautions

To ensure optimal performance, the FAN6961 should be operated within its specified voltage and temperature ranges. Proper heat dissipation is essential, especially in high-power applications, to prevent thermal overload. ESD precautions must be observed during handling and installation to avoid damage to the IC. Regular inspection of the surrounding components, such as capacitors and resistors, is recommended to maintain system integrity. Avoid exposing the IC to moisture or corrosive environments, as this can degrade its performance over time.

B2B Procurement Guide

When procuring the FAN6961, verify the supplier’s authenticity to avoid counterfeit products. Reliable distributors often provide technical support and datasheets to assist with integration. Bulk purchases may offer cost savings, but ensure compatibility with your design requirements before committing. Consider lead times and minimum order quantities (MOQs) when planning procurement. For reference, prices typically range from $0.50 to $1.50 per unit, though this can vary based on volume and supplier. Always request samples for testing before large-scale orders.
